Transaction 8e21e1684f1a96a7832f0634f178ffa1c97417cdcd6952e866f04a44c9393b93
1 Input
2 Outputs
- 8e21e1684f1a96a7832f0634f178ffa1c97417cdcd6952e866f04a44c9393b93:0
- 8e21e1684f1a96a7832f0634f178ffa1c97417cdcd6952e866f04a44c9393b93:1
value 629380
address 1MudGuzDVAtD7c7cexFRPV3iXZaBCYLx7m
value 805485173
address 1FxNgXf5ipZPRV52Tu3bPDiyvh1TYWLMhz